low hcg levels;early recurrent miscarriage

by Bryn, Apr 25, 2003 12:00AM
I have had three miscarriages (all at 5-6 weeks) and am now pregnant again.  My hcg levels were doubling initially between week 4 and 5, then started only going up by about 35-40% every two days.  They are now at 1140 (I'm at just over 6 weeks) and I have had brown staining and some bleeding for the last couple of weeks but no cramping.  My doctor seems certain that this pregnancy will end in miscarriage or is an ectopic and wants to do a D&C right away.  I don't want to until there is absolutely no hope, has anyone had a similar circumstance?  Can they tell if it's an ectopic just from an ultrasound or is surgery necessary?
Has anyone else had a similar problem with early recurrent miscarriages?
